Outlook API, получить несколько сообщений от идентификаторов сообщений - PullRequest
0 голосов
/ 29 июня 2018

Я использую Microsoft Graph API. Я хотел бы знать, возможно ли для данного пользователя получить список сообщений (почты) из списка идентификаторов сообщений?

У меня есть список сообщений ID; Можно ли с помощью Microsoft Graph API получить список соответствующих сообщений? (Я не хочу использовать пакет, потому что он ограничен 20 результатами).

Есть эта конечная точка: https://msdn.microsoft.com/en-us/office/office365/api/mail-rest-operations# Это позволяет получить одно сообщение, указав его идентификатор. Мне нужно получить несколько сообщений (например, 500), указав идентификаторы. Это возможно ?

1 Ответ

0 голосов
/ 29 июня 2018

Это невозможно в Graph API.
Единственная операция, которая возвращает список сообщений, возвращает список сообщений указанной папки

GET /me/messages                      (returns all messages of the mailbox)
GET /me/mailFolders/{id}/messages     (returns all messages of a folder inside the mailbox)

от https://developer.microsoft.com/en-us/graph/docs/api-reference/beta/api/user_list_messages

Ваш единственный вариант - использовать пакетный запрос.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...